The ferry from Ios to Piraeus connects the Greek island of
Ios with the Greek mainland. The route is offered several times a day by the shipping companies
Cyclades Fast Ferries,
Aegean Sea Lines,
Zante Ferries,
Blue Star Ferries and
SeaJets. The journey time is between 4:15 hours and 10:10 hours, depending on the shipping company.

Ios
If you are looking for a party, you can't avoid the island of Ios. It is considered the true center of nightlife in the Cyclades and is therefore especially popular with young people. However, if you are an early riser and like to have the beach to yourself, you will probably also find your happiness here - because due to the party nights, it usually only gets a bit livelier on the beaches in the afternoon. Worth seeing are especially the monastery Agia Ioannis and the regional wine growing.
